5. Setup and Installation

Installation of a starter motor requires mechanical expertise and specialized tools. It is strongly recommended that this procedure be performed by a certified automotive technician.

General Installation Steps (Consult Vehicle Service Manual for Specifics):

  1. Preparation: Ensure the vehicle is on a level surface, the parking brake is engaged, and the wheels are chocked. Disconnect the negative battery terminal, then the positive terminal.
  2. Access: Depending on the vehicle model, gaining access to the starter may require removing other components (e.g., intake manifold, exhaust pipes, heat shields). Refer to your vehicle's specific service manual for detailed instructions.
  3. Disconnect Wiring: Carefully disconnect the electrical connections from the old starter. This typically includes a large battery cable and a smaller solenoid wire. Note their positions for reinstallation.
  4. Remove Old Starter: Unbolt the old starter from the engine block or transmission housing. Be prepared for the starter to be heavy.
  5. Install New Starter: Position the new Valeo 438266 starter and secure it with the mounting bolts. Ensure proper torque specifications are met as per your vehicle's service manual.
  6. Connect Wiring: Reconnect the electrical wires to the new starter. Ensure all connections are clean, tight, and correctly oriented.
  7. Reassemble: Reinstall any components that were removed to access the starter.
  8. Reconnect Battery: Reconnect the positive battery terminal, then the negative terminal.
  9. Test: Attempt to start the vehicle and check for proper operation.

8. Troubleshooting

If you experience issues with engine starting after installing the Valeo 438266 starter, consider the following common troubleshooting steps:

SymptomPossible CauseAction
Engine does not crank or cranks slowlyWeak or dead batteryTest battery voltage. Recharge or replace battery if necessary.
Engine does not crank, but lights and accessories workLoose or corroded battery cables/starter connectionsInspect and clean all battery and starter cable connections. Ensure they are tight.
Clicking sound when attempting to startLow battery voltage, faulty starter solenoid, or poor connectionsCheck battery. Verify solenoid wire connection. If battery is good and connections are tight, the solenoid or starter may require professional diagnosis.
Starter spins but engine does not crankFaulty starter drive (bendix)This indicates an internal starter issue. Professional replacement is required.
Starter remains engaged after engine startsFaulty starter solenoid or ignition switchImmediately turn off the engine. Seek professional diagnosis to prevent damage to the starter and flywheel.

If these steps do not resolve the issue, or if you are unsure about performing any diagnostic steps, consult a qualified automotive technician.

9. Specifications

SpecificationValue
Model Number438266
Manufacturer Part Number438266
OEM Part Numbers2769062500; 276906250080; TS14E6
BrandValeo
Wattage1.4 KW
Voltage12V
Item Weight6.34 pounds (2.88 Kilograms)
Product Dimensions (L x W x H)11.42 x 6.1 x 5.51 inches
